The Jazz gave up Magic and Moses for Gail Goodrich??? I know it "saved" the organization, but that has to be up there with the Baby Ruth trade as the worst in history.

Unfortunately, yes. The Jazz traded 3 picks for the right to sign Gail Goodrich. One of those picks was the one the Lakers used for Magic Johnson. And one was returned to the Jazz when they gave up the rights to Moses Malone and he could go into the ABA expansion draft - ending up in Houston.

"Malone's NBA rights had previously been held by the New Orleans Jazz, but the NBA let them place Malone into the draft pool in exchange for the return of their first-round draft pick in 1977, which they used to trade for Gail Goodrich."
